I just wanted to clear some thing up on the ESX.
1. The tubes actually do not help the sound, the more you turn it up the muddier it gets. (with factory tubes)
2. The factory tubes create a lot of white noise, these can be replaced to get a crunchier/warmer sound with less noise. ($40 upgrade)
3. ESX samples at 44.1khz (only sample mode). You have mono or stereo. No lofi modes.
4. ESX AC adapter is VERY noisy (I've confirmed this with 2 other owners). It will vibrate and hum if you put the ac adapter on a desk.
The ESX is a great machine and I put a lot of time into mine over the years, but I recently sold it. It had just been collecting dust for the last year since i got my Zoom Sampletrak. If you got the money to burn pick one up. Just a warming, these machines are not for everybody.
